When Would You Want to Die?
A son speaks for the first time about finding his elderly parents dead after a suicide pact. It’s a choice he believes they should have had a legal right to make. Are things about to change?

As lawmakers prepare to debate whether doctors should be allowed to help some patients take their own lives, what might the consequences of this be? Wyre Davies investigates.
